ABSTRACT:
The invention is a projectile stabilizing fin formed with a laterally exting flat, triangular shaped tab positioned so that one point of the triangle points in the direction of the intended projectile direction and tilted so that air flow will impinge on the tab surface and cause the projectile to spin. Such construction is particularly useful for projectiles launched from smooth bore guns at high Kinetic Energy.
